Miles between Richmond, CA and Charlotte, NC

There are
2,720 mi
from Richmond, CA to Charlotte, NC

That's the driving distance. It would take 2 days to go from Richmond, California to Charlotte, North Carolina.

The flight distance (direct flight from Richmond, CA to Charlotte, NC) is 2,291.42 mi.

2,720 mi = 3.22 kms